Solve the following pair of simultaneous equations.

3x + 2.6y = 16 and x + 5.2y = 27

Given equations:

3x + 2.6y = 16    ...(1)

x + 5.2y = 27    ...(2)

Here, multiplying equations (1) and (2) by 10 to remove decimals:

10(3x) + 10(2.6y) = 10(16)

30x + 26y = 160    ...(3)

10(x) + 10(5.2y) = 10(27)

10x + 52y = 270    ...(4)

Also, multiplying equation (4) by 3:

3(10x) + 3(52y) = 3(270)

30x + 156y = 810    ...(5)

Now, subtracting equation (3) from equation (5):

(30x + 156y) − (30x + 26y) = 810 − 160

30x + 156y − 30x − 26y = 650

156y − 26y = 650

130y = 650

y = `650/130`

∴ y = 5

Let’s substitute y = 5 into equation (2):

x + 5.2(5) = 27

x + 26 = 27

x = 27 − 26

∴ x = 1
